nsiregar / pegelinux

Blog aggregator for pegelinux community
https://pegelinux.id
MIT License
10 stars 9 forks source link

Bump sentry-sdk from 0.13.2 to 0.18.0 #225

Closed dependabot-preview[bot] closed 4 years ago

dependabot-preview[bot] commented 4 years ago

Bumps sentry-sdk from 0.13.2 to 0.18.0.

Release notes

Sourced from sentry-sdk's releases.

0.18.0

  • Breaking change: The no_proxy environment variable is now honored when inferring proxy settings from the system. Thanks Xavier Fernandez!
  • Added Performance/Tracing support for AWS and GCP functions.
  • Fix an issue with Django instrumentation where the SDK modified resolver_match.callback and broke user code.

0.17.8

  • Fix yet another bug with disjoint traces in Celery.
  • Added support for Chalice 1.20. Thanks again to the folks at Cuenca MX!

0.17.7

  • Internal: Change data category for transaction envelopes.
  • Fix a bug under Celery 4.2+ that may have caused disjoint traces or missing transactions.

0.17.6

  • Support for Flask 0.10 (only relaxing verson check)

0.17.5

  • Work around an issue in the Python stdlib that makes the entire process deadlock during garbage collection if events are sent from a __del__ implementation.
  • Add possibility to wrap ASGI application twice in middleware to enable split up of request scope data and exception catching.

0.17.4

  • New integration for the Chalice web framework for AWS Lambda. Thanks to the folks at Cuenca MX!

0.17.3

  • Fix an issue with the pure_eval integration in interaction with trimming where pure_eval would create a lot of useless local variables that then drown out the useful ones in trimming.

0.17.2

  • Fix timezone bugs in GCP integration.

0.17.1

  • Fix timezone bugs in AWS Lambda integration.
  • Fix crash on GCP integration because of missing parameter timeout_warning.

0.17.0

  • Fix a bug where class-based callables used as Django views (without using Django's regular class-based views) would not have csrf_exempt applied.
  • New integration for Google Cloud Functions.
  • Fix a bug where a recently released version of urllib3 would cause the SDK to enter an infinite loop on networking and SSL errors.
  • Breaking change: Remove the traceparent_v2 option. The option has been ignored since 0.16.3, just remove it from your code.

0.16.5

  • Fix a bug that caused Django apps to crash if the view didn't have a __name__ attribute.

0.16.4

  • Add experiment to avoid trunchating span descriptions. Initialize with init(_experiments={"smart_transaction_trimming": True}).
  • Add a span around the Django view in transactions to distinguish its operations from middleware operations.
Changelog

Sourced from sentry-sdk's changelog.

0.18.0

  • Breaking change: The no_proxy environment variable is now honored when inferring proxy settings from the system. Thanks Xavier Fernandez!
  • Added Performance/Tracing support for AWS and GCP functions.
  • Fix an issue with Django instrumentation where the SDK modified resolver_match.callback and broke user code.

0.17.8

  • Fix yet another bug with disjoint traces in Celery.
  • Added support for Chalice 1.20. Thanks again to the folks at Cuenca MX!

0.17.7

  • Internal: Change data category for transaction envelopes.
  • Fix a bug under Celery 4.2+ that may have caused disjoint traces or missing transactions.

0.17.6

  • Support for Flask 0.10 (only relaxing version check)

0.17.5

  • Work around an issue in the Python stdlib that makes the entire process deadlock during garbage collection if events are sent from a __del__ implementation.
  • Add possibility to wrap ASGI application twice in middleware to enable split up of request scope data and exception catching.

0.17.4

  • New integration for the Chalice web framework for AWS Lambda. Thanks to the folks at Cuenca MX!

0.17.3

  • Fix an issue with the pure_eval integration in interaction with trimming where pure_eval would create a lot of useless local variables that then drown out the useful ones in trimming.

0.17.2

  • Fix timezone bugs in GCP integration.

0.17.1

  • Fix timezone bugs in AWS Lambda integration.
  • Fix crash on GCP integration because of missing parameter timeout_warning.

0.17.0

  • Fix a bug where class-based callables used as Django views (without using Django's regular class-based views) would not have csrf_exempt applied.
  • New integration for Google Cloud Functions.
  • Fix a bug where a recently released version of urllib3 would cause the SDK to enter an infinite loop on networking and SSL errors.
  • Breaking change: Remove the traceparent_v2 option. The option has been
Commits
  • a7f5725 release: 0.18.0
  • 8649feb doc: Changelog for 0.18.0
  • 5d89fa7 fix(django): Do not patch resolver_match (#842)
  • cdf21de Capturing Performance monitoring transactions for AWS and GCP (#830)
  • 7022cd8 chore: Remove failing Django test from CI
  • 867beae chore: Add Celery 5 to CI (#839)
  • 4d16ef6 Add basic support for no_proxy environment variable (#838)
  • 86d14b0 fix(serialization): Do not crash if tag is nan (#835)
  • db86d61 tests: parametrize proxy tests (#836)
  • e234998 feat(envelope): Add some useful envelope methods (#793)
  • Additional commits viewable in compare view


Dependabot compatibility score

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.


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R: - `@dependabot rebase` will rebase this PR - `@dependabot recreate` will recreate this PR, overwriting any edits that have been made to it - `@dependabot merge` will merge this PR after your CI passes on it - `@dependabot squash and merge` will squash and merge this PR after your CI passes on it - `@dependabot cancel merge` will cancel a previously requested merge and block automerging - `@dependabot reopen` will reopen this PR if it is closed - `@dependabot close` will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ually - `@dependabot ignore this major version` will close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self) - `@dependabot ignore this minor version` will close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self) - `@dependabot ignore this dependency` will close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self) - `@dependabot use these labels` will set the current labels as the default for future PRs for this repo and language - `@dependabot use these reviewers` will set the current reviewers as the default for future PRs for this repo and language - `@dependabot use these assignees` will set the current assignees as the default for future PRs for this repo and language - `@dependabot use this milestone` will set the current milestone as the default for future PRs for this repo and language - `@dependabot badge me` will comment on this PR with code to add a "Dependabot enabled" badge to your readme Additionally, you can set the following in your Dependabot [dashboard](https://app.dependabot.com): - Update frequency (including time of day and day of week) - Pull request limits (per update run and/or open at any time) - Out-of-range updates (receive only lockfile updates, if desired) - Security updates (receive only security updates, if desired)
dependabot-preview[bot] commented 4 years ago

Superseded by #230.